Water Removal Service: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and dry yourself.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ely dry and dehumidify. |
| Roof leak causing water damage |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and repair the roof.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and repair the pipe. |
| Hidden water damage in walls |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ely detect and repair. |

Water Removal Service Cost In The 2482 Area
The cost of water removal service in the 2482 area can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may not reflect the actual cost of your specific job. Get a free estimate today to find out the exact cost of your water removal service.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of drying process |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of moisture detection |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, severity of sewage spill |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of recovery process |
| Water Damage Restoration | $3,000 – $15,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
